Identifying and linking output bins

There is one standard output bin on all printer models. Depending on the model you selected, your output bin capacity is
250 or 500 sheets. If you need additional output capacity, there are several optional output bins available for the printer.
If you have multiple output bins, you can link them into a single output source. Linking output bins lets the printer
automatically switch output to the next available bin.
